Isabel Denise Rodriguez is a dynamic left-wing back for the Kansas City Current in the National Women's Soccer League (NWSL). At 27, she has already demonstrated her ability to impact the game significantly, contributing to an agile and forward-thinking defensive line. During her time with the team, Rodriguez has played 2 matches, amassing 201 minutes on the field. While she has not scored a goal, her offensive contributions are amplified through her exceptional ability to create opportunities for her teammates. Averaging 0.51 assists per game, she is a key playmaker, orchestrating offensive plays that often lead to scoring chances. Her playmaker rank of 3.5 reflects her influence in setting up goals and enhancing the team's attacking potential.
Rodriguez excels in both progressing the ball and shutting down the opposition. Her progressive passing distance records an impressive 260.67 yards per game, a testament to her vision and ability to link defense to attack seamlessly. Additionally, she has a respectable xG (expected goals) per game of 0.06, alongside an average of 1.01 shots, indicating her willingness to push forward when opportunities arise. Defensively, she is rock-solid, achieving 2.5 interceptions and 3.5 challenges per game—both possession-adjusted—highlighting her ability to disrupt opposing plays effectively. With a challenge success rate of 70%, Rodriguez remains a reliable defender capable of neutralizing threats. Her playing style typifies a "Creator" archetype, making her an invaluable asset to Kansas City Current's strategy on the field.
